Company Profile:
Founded as a focused water-technology company in 2011, Xylem Inc. has grown into one of the world’s leading providers of water infrastructure and applied water solutions. Born from the water-related businesses spun off from ITT Corporation, Xylem combines a century-plus heritage of pump and instrumentation brands with a modern mission to solve global water challenges — from safe drinking water and resilient utilities to industrial process water and smart metering. The company serves customers in more than 150 countries and emphasizes sustainability, innovation, and digitalisation across its global operations.
Xylem provides a wide range of water treatment equipment and integrated solutions for customers requiring reliable water infrastructure and industrial water management systems. As a globally recognized water technology company, Xylem supplies pumps, filtration systems, wastewater treatment equipment, monitoring instruments, and smart water solutions for municipal and industrial applications. Through its engineering capabilities and extensive product portfolio, the company supports water treatment plant equipment suppliers, utilities, and industrial users with scalable systems designed for water reuse, process optimization, and long-term performance. Xylem’s solutions are widely applied in industries where efficient water handling, treatment, and monitoring are critical.
Establishment: 2011
Headquarters: Washington, D.C., United States

Company Profile:
Evoqua Water Technologies grew quickly into a leading specialist in mission-critical water and wastewater treatment solutions after its corporate formation in the 2010s. The company built a reputation for providing engineered systems, aftermarket service and rental solutions to utilities and industrial customers worldwide — with strong footholds in power generation, semiconductor, food & beverage, and municipal markets. Although Evoqua’s roots trace to multiple long-standing legacy businesses, the modern Evoqua brand was established through a series of targeted acquisitions and an initial public profile in the 2010s, and it is known for customer-focused project delivery, service reliability and a broad installed base of treatment assets.
In 2023 Evoqua was acquired by Xylem, and many Evoqua technologies and service offerings now sit within Xylem’s broader water-technology platform while continuing to be marketed under trusted Evoqua brand names in certain markets. This combination expanded Xylem’s treatment, disinfection and specialty technologies and reinforced Evoqua’s position in membrane systems, specialty disinfection and industrial water services.
Evoqua Water Technologies specializes in engineered water treatment systems and industrial water solutions, serving customers that require high-performance equipment for complex applications. The company has developed expertise in advanced treatment technologies such as ion exchange systems, electrodeionization, membrane filtration, ultraviolet disinfection, and modular water treatment units. Its equipment is widely used in industries including power generation, semiconductor manufacturing, pharmaceuticals, and municipal water treatment. For companies searching for industrial water treatment systems manufacturers, Evoqua represents a supplier focused on customized engineering solutions, lifecycle services, and reliable water treatment plant equipment.
Establishment: 2010s
Headquarters: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, United States.

Company Profile:
Founded in 1949, Kurita Water Industries Ltd. is a Japanese water-technology company with a long history of supplying chemicals, equipment and services for industrial and municipal water treatment. Kurita began as a boiler water-treatment chemical business and expanded into facilities, process chemicals, R&D and lifecycle services. Today the Kurita Group operates globally with subsidiaries across Asia, the Americas and Europe, positioning itself as a practical partner for industries seeking to improve water efficiency, reduce environmental impact and maintain regulatory compliance.
Kurita Water Industries delivers comprehensive water treatment solutions by combining equipment manufacturing, chemical technologies, and operational services. The company supplies industrial water treatment equipment including reverse osmosis systems, filtration units, wastewater treatment facilities, ultrapure water systems, and water recycling solutions. Kurita mainly serves industrial customers in sectors such as electronics, energy, petrochemical, steel, and manufacturing, where stable water quality is essential. With strong technical expertise, Kurita helps customers build efficient treatment systems and provides customized solutions that reduce water consumption and improve production reliability.
Establishment: 1949
Headquarters: Nakano-ku, Tokyo, Japan

Company Profile:
Ovivo Inc. is a global water and wastewater treatment specialist built from more than a century of heritage brands and system-integration expertise. The company traces its corporate roots through Groupe Laperrière & Verreault (GL&V) and rebranded as Ovivo in December 2014 when it refocused exclusively on water technologies. Today Ovivo operates an integrated global platform with offices and manufacturing in many markets and is majority-owned by SKion Water GmbH; the business emphasises sustainable, engineered solutions for municipal and industrial customers worldwide.
Ovivo is a specialized water treatment equipment manufacturer providing engineered solutions for industrial and municipal water applications. The company designs and supplies advanced treatment equipment including filtration systems, membrane technologies, clarification equipment, sludge treatment systems, and modular water treatment plants. Ovivo focuses on customized projects where customers require specific solutions for water purification, wastewater treatment, and resource recovery. With strong engineering capabilities and global project experience, Ovivo serves industries that need professional water treatment equipment suppliers capable of delivering complete systems from design to installation.
Establishment: 1975
Headquarters: Montréal, Québec, Canada

Water treatment equipment manufacturers usually provide different systems based on water sources and application needs.
The right equipment depends on whether the goal is drinking water purification, industrial production, wastewater reuse, or desalination.
| Equipment Type | Main Application | Common Industries |
|---|---|---|
| Reverse Osmosis (RO) System | Remove dissolved salts and impurities | Food, beverage, pharmaceutical, electronics |
| Ultrafiltration System | Remove suspended solids and microorganisms | Municipal water, industrial pretreatment |
| Wastewater Treatment Plant Equipment | Treat and recycle wastewater | Manufacturing, chemical, textile industries |
| Desalination Equipment | Convert seawater into fresh water | Coastal areas, large infrastructure projects |
For example, an electronics factory producing precision components may require an ultrapure water system with RO, EDI, and advanced filtration technologies to prevent production defects.
